The complete chloroplast genome sequence of Ligularia stenocephala (Maxim.) Matsum. & Koidz. (Asteraceae: Senecioneae)
Ligularia stenocephala (Maxim.) Matsum. & Koidz is a widely known edible plant species in Korea. It contains various useful antioxidant compounds and has been developed as a horticultural cultivar blooming showy inflorescence. We report the complete plastid genome (plastome) of Ligularia stenoce...
